Connecting with a USB connection cable

Preparations:
Turn on the camera and the PC.
Remove the card before using the pictures in the built-in memory.
A USB connection cable (supplied)
Check the directions of the connectors, and plug them straight in or unplug them straight out.
(Otherwise the connectors may be bent out of shape which may cause malfunction.)
B Align the marks, and insert.
Use a battery with sufficient battery power or the AC adaptor (optional). If the remaining battery
power becomes low while the camera and the PC are communicating, the status indicator
blinks and the alarm beeps.

Connect the camera to a PC via the USB connection cable A
(supplied).
Do not use any other USB connection cables except the supplied one. Use of cables
other than the supplied USB connection cable may cause malfunction.
Touch [PC].
If [USB Mode]
automatically connected to the PC without displaying the [USB Mode] selection screen.
When the camera has been connected to the PC with [USB Mode] set to
[PictBridge(PTP)], a message may appear on the PC's screen. Select [Cancel] to close
the screen, and disconnect the camera from the PC. Then set [USB Mode] to [PC]
again.
Operate the PC.
You can save the images into the PC by drag and drop the image or the folder with the
image you would like to transfer onto the different folder in the PC.
